NCE 4101 – CE Integration 1 – Algebra Part 3
IX. ARITHMETIC PROGRESSION
36. The 7th term of an arithmetic sequence is
34 while the 11th term is 286. What is the
24th term? What term is 727? What is the
sum of the first 200 terms?
37. Insert 7 arithmetic means between 69 and
93.
38. How many numbers divisible by 4 lie
between 70 and 203?
39. What is the sum of all odd integers between
10 and 500?
40. Determine x so that 2x + 1, 10x - 15, 2x^2 +
9 will be an arithmetic progression
X. GEOMETRIC PROGRESSION
41. The 7th term of a geometric progression is
34 while the 11th term is 544. What is the
24th term? What term is 17,408? What is
the sum of the first 200 terms?
42. Insert 4 geometric means between 2,048
and 2
43. Find the geometric mean of 2, 7, 9, 11.
XI. HARMONIC PROGRESSION
44. The second and fourth term of a harmonic
progression is 5/4 and - 8. Find the 6th
term.
45. The geometric mean and the arithmetic
mean of two numbers are 8 and 17,
respectively. Find the harmonic mean.
46. It took a certain vehicle 3 hours to travel a
distance of 120 km. On its way back, it took
him only 2 hours to travel the same path.
What was his average speed? (space mean
speed)
XIII. DIOPHANTINE EQUATION
47. Find the value of x in the equation 14 x +
35y = 91. Assume x and y are both positive
integers. a) 5 b) 3 c) 6 d) 4
48. Three items A, B and C were sold in a store.
Item A costs P 10.00 each, item B costs P
1.00 each and three pieces of item C cost
P1.00. The total sales at the end of the day
were P100.00 and a total of 100 items were
sold. How many of item B were sold? a) 42
b) 40 c) 54 d) 49
XIV. NUMBER / DIGIT PROBLEMS
49. The sum of the digits of a three-digit
number is 17. If the digits are reversed and
the resulting number is added to the
original number, the result is 1,474. If the
resulting number is subtracted from the
original number the result is 396. Find the
original number.
50. The sum of the digits of a 2-digit number is
10. If the number is divided by the units
digit, the quotient is 3 and the remainder is
4. Find the number.
